Who was the famous king of Lodhi dynasty?

The first Lodī ruler was Bahlūl Lodī (reigned 1451–89), the most powerful of the Punjab chiefs, who replaced the last king of the Sayyid dynasty in 1451. Bahlūl was a vigorous leader, holding together a loose confederacy of Afghan and Turkish chiefs with his strong personality.

The Tomb of Sikandar Lodi is the tomb of the second ruler of the Lodi Dynasty, Sikandar Lodi (reign: 1489–1517 CE) situated in New Delhi, India. The tomb is situated in Lodhi Gardens in Delhi and was built in 1517–1518 CE by his son Ibrahim Lodi.

The Lodi dynasty was founded by Bahlul Lodi in 1451 CE. Bahlul Lodi was the Governor of Lahore and Sirhind when the Sultan of Delhi was Alam Shah, the last of the Syed Sultans.

Where did Daulat Khan fight Babur?

He died on the way to Bhera, where he was to have been imprisoned. The events that Daulat Khan had started in motion by inviting Babur to India finally culminated in the battle of Panipat in 1526, where Ibrahim Khan Lodi lost his life.

Was Ibrahim Lodi a good ruler?

Ibrahim Lodi was a very cruel and high headed ruler who was known for his atrocities. He even failed to have good relations with the nobles. He got them imprisoned and was also cruel to his officials and killed and poisoned many noblemen.

Why is Sikandar famous?

Sikandar was a capable ruler who encouraged trade across his territory. He expanded Lodi territory into the regions of Gwalior and Bihar. He made a treaty with Alauddin Hussain Shah and his kingdom of Bengal. In 1503, he commissioned the building of the present-day city of Agra.

Sikandar Lodi, whose real name was Nizam Khan, rose the throne of Delhi in 1489 A.D. and administered up to 1517 A.D. He was the second ruler of Lodhi dynasty.

Who was Bahlul Lodi?

Bahlul Lodi or Bahlul Khan was a grandson of Malik Bahram, a Pashtun native to Multan working for the Governor of Multan. Bahlul was the son of Bahram’s younger son Malik Kala.

What is the history of Seri Bahlol?

Seri Bahlol is at the center of the Gandhara area. Seri Bahlol is a historical place and it has been included in the UNESCO World Heritage List since 1980. The ruins of Seri Bahlol are the remnants of a small ancient fortified town built during the Kushan period. The city was protected during the time of John Marshall.

Who was the founder of the Lodi dynasty?

Bahlul Khan Lodi, the founder of the Lodi dynasty which ruled over Delhi for 75 years, died on 12th July 1489. Bahlul’s death in 1489 was followed by a power struggle between his two sons. Nizam Khan succeeded him as the ruler of Delhi and assumed the name, Sikandar Lodi.
